Tata Motors has been working on the next generation Sumo which is expected on sale in 2018.

Media reports said the vehicle will cost between INR600,000 and INR900,000 and would replace the Movus. It may have a smaller engine with power output similar to the current Sumo Gold. The company is developing the new model to meet the new Indian crash test rules.

The new Sumo will use technology from Tata’s Land Rover unit and be built on a completely new platform, the media reports said.
